Canned Salmon Burgers

These keto canned salmon burgers are not only easy to make but also packed with nutrients and flavor. They’re perfect for a quick lunch or dinner and can easily be doubled to serve a crowd or freeze for later.

- 14 oz canned salmon, drained
- 1 large egg
- ½ cup Parmesan cheese, grated
- 1 cup almond flour
- 1 clove gar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ons fresh dill,chopped
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½ teaspoon black pepper
- 1 tablespoon olive oil (for frying)
In a large mixing bowl, combine the drained canned salmon, almond flour, egg, Parmesan cheese, garlic, dill,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Mix until all the ingredients are well incorporated. The mixture should hold together when pressed.
Divide the salmon mixture into 4 equal portions and shape each portion into a patty, about ½ inch thick. Place the patties on a plate and refrigerate for 15-20 minutes to help them firm up.
Pan Fry
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Once the oil is hot, carefully add the salmon patties to the skillet. Cook for 3-4 minutes on each side, or until golden brown and crispy on the outside. The internal temperature should reach 145°F (63°C).
Air Fry
Preheat the air fryer as per the manufacturers instructions.
Place the salmon burgers in the basket and cook at 350°F (175°C) for 5-8 minutes, flipping halfway through.
Serve
Serve the salmon burgers on a bed of lettuce or keto-friendly buns with your favorite toppings, such as sliced avocado, tomato, or extra mayo.
